# Virginia SB 301 (2020) — Medically underserved areas; transporting patients to 24-hour urgent care facilities.
Medically underserved areas; emergency medicalservices; medical care facilities. Provides that emergency medicalservices vehicles may transport patients to 24-hour urgent care medicalfacilities or other appropriate medical facilities when deemed appropriateby emergency medical services personnel or a physician. The billrequires the Board of Health to develop regulations for when emergencymedical services agencies in medically underserved areas as defined by the Board may transport patients to 24-hour urgent care facilitiesor appropriate medical care facilities other than hospitals. Theregulations shall include provisions for what constitutes a medicallyunderserved area, cases appropriate for transferring a patient toa medical facility other than a hospital, and other information deemedrelevant by the Board.
